Secondary Information Evening

Date: Tuesday 15 November 2011
Time: 18:15 - 20:00
Venue: The Foyer, School of Education and Lifelong Learning, UEA, Norwich

We offer the one-year, full-time Postgraduate Certificate in Education (PGCE) route into teaching. The course is assessed against Masters Level criteria - leading to Qualified Teacher Status and 60 credits at Masters Level.

The general information session will commence at 18:15 and will be followed by subject talks in groups:

English
Geography
History
Mathematics
Modern Foreign Languages (specialising in either/or: French, German, Spanish)
Physical Education
Religious Education
Science (Biology, Chemistry or Physics)

Secondary tutors will be available to answer all subject-related questions throughout the evening. PGCE Admissions staff will also be available to answer questions on the admissions process and entry requirements.
